Cost and Renovation Timeline
Average Renovation Pricing in WA
Most affordable landscape renovation projects in Maple Valley range from $5,000 to $20,000, depending on scope and materials. Small updates like mulching, lighting, or minor planting may cost under $3,000, while full-yard transformations with outdoor patio construction and drainage work can exceed $30,000. Factors like site access, grading needs, and King County permits influence final pricing. A detailed bid breaks down every cost so you can plan wisely.

Estimated Timeline from Start to Finish
From consultation to completion, most yard transformation services take 4 to 12 weeks. Simple renovations like planting and mulching wrap up in 1–2 weeks, while complex builds with deck and paver work or drainage systems may stretch into months. Permit approval, weather delays, and material availability can affect scheduling. A reliable firm provides a clear project calendar and updates you at every milestone.

Compliant Hillside Development
Developing on sloped lots? King County enforces strict rules for grading, erosion control, and property drainage assessment to avoid landslides and water damage. Our team performs comprehensive soil testing services and designs drainage solutions such as swales that meet code while enhancing your yard’s function.
- Create gravity walls to stabilize soil and comply with slope limits
- Guide stormwater away from foundations using surface grading
Tree Removal Restrictions
Clearing certain trees in Maple Valley requires permits—even on private property—due to King County’s wildlife habitat ordinances. Size, species, location, and health all factor into whether a tree qualifies as protected, especially for mature evergreens.
Be sure to consult a certified nursery professional before any removal. We provide expert assessments and assist with permit applications to keep your project moving forward legally.
